HubSpot Logo

HubSpot

Locations: 25 1st St Cambridge, Massachusetts 02141, US + (+11 more)

Company Size: 700 & Above

Industry: Software Development

Company Website

AI Description

drawer
  • Clarissa Sung profile image

    Customer Support Specialist

  • Asseel S. profile image

    Senior Software Engineer @ HubSpot

  • Stephen Fiske profile image

    Head of Video at HubSpot

  • Kieran McCarthy profile image

    Senior Web Developer II at HubSpot

  • Jaycie Weathers profile image

    Sr. Customer Success Manager @HubSpot

  • Daynah Burnett profile image

    UX Content Design at HubSpot

Showing 36 to 42 of 1000 results